sexta-feira, 3 de setembro de 2010

Exchange - Setar tamanho das Caixas via Shell

Para ajustar o tamanho da caixa postal via Shell Script, utilize o seguinte comando

Set-Mailbox -Identity <caixaPostal> -IssueWarningQuota <valor> -ProhibitSendQuota <valor> -ProhibitSendReceiveQuota <valor> -UseDatabaseQuotaDefault $false

Onde:
IssueWarningQuota - Exchange avisa que o limite da cota está próximo
ProhibitSendQuota - Exchange bloqueia o envio e Mensagens
ProhibitSendReceiveQuota - Exchange bloqueia o Envio/Recebimento de Mensagens

valor = Valor em KB; ou
valor = unlimited

Exchange - Filtros nos Imports/Exports de Caixa

Algumas vezes precisamos filtrar algum tipo de mensagem com base no Assunto, Rementete,
Destinário. O console Shell do Exchange dá um força para isso. (Estes comandos são utilizados
com os comandos do post Anterior "Exchange - Manipulação de Caixas Postais>

:: Para excluir mensagens
-DeleteContent

:: Para filtrar por Assunto
-SubjectKeywords <palavras>

::Para filtrar por Rementente
-SenderKeywords <palavras>

:: Para filtrar por Destinatário
-RecipientKeywords <palavras>

Exchange - Manipulação de Caixas Postais

Para exportar emails de uma determinada caixa postal para outra, utilize os seguintes comandos Shell Script no console do Microsoft Exchange:

:: Setar Permissões
Add-MailboxPermission -Identity <caixaUsuario> -User <usuario> - AccessRights FullAccess

caixaUsuario = a caixa postal que será manipulada
usuario = o usuário que realizará a manipulação

:: Exportar Mensagens para outra Caixa
Export-Mailbox -Identity <caixaOrigem> -TargetMailbox <caixaDestino> -TargetFolder <pasta>

:: Exportar Mensagens para um arquivo .pst
Export-Mailbox -Identity <caixaOrigem> -PstFolderpath <caminho\nomeArquivo.pst>

:: Importar Mensagens de um arquivo .pst
Import-Mailbox -Identity <caixaDestino> -PstFolderpath <caminho\nomeArquivo.pst>

::Filtrar por Assunto
-SubjectKeyWords <palavra>


:: Filtrar por Rementente
-SenderKeywords <palavra>

:: Filtrar por Destinatário
-RecipientKeywords <palavra>


:: Filtrar por Data de Inicio
-StartDate dd/MM/yy


:: Filtrar por Data Final
-EndDate dd/MM/yy

Editor padrão no Linux

Para setar o editor de texto padrão em Linux basta exportar a variável EDITOR com o valor para o novo editor de texto.

#export EDITOR=/usr/bin/vi

Para tornar esta alteração "eterna" para todos os usuários digite este comando no arquivo /etc/rc.local

Para tornar esta alteração "eterna" para apenas um usuário digite este comando no arquivo <usuario>/.bashrc

quinta-feira, 2 de setembro de 2010

Erro ao aplicar "Encaminhar Mensagem"

Algumas vezes quando vamos configurar o encaminhamento de mensagens para outro usuário nos deparamos com algums problemas no Exchange. Uma provável solução para este problema é certificar-se que o serviço "Atendedor do Sistema do Microsoft Exchange" está iniciado e executando sem problemas. Para isso:
  1. Iniciar > Executar > Digite "services.msc" > ENTER
  2. Localize na Janela Serviços o serviço referido e verifique seu Status

Exchange não Aplica Novo de Tamanho de Caixa

As alterações realizadas com relação ao tamanho das Caixas Postais dos usuários do Microsoft Exchange acontecem através de processo de manunteção agendamento pelo próprio Exchange. Algumas vezes temos pressa em aplicar estas alterações, então ai vai a dica:

Reinicie o serviço "Armazenamento de Informação do Microsoft Exchange"

  1. Clique em Iniciar > Executar > Digite services.msc.
  2. Localize o serviço "Armazenamento de Informação do Microsoft Exchange"
  3. Reinicie o serviço da forma que preferir.